legnare

Italian

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/leɲˈɲa.re/
  • Rhymes: -are
  • Hyphenation: le‧gnà‧re

Etymology 1

From legno (wood) +‎ -are.

Verb

legnàre (first-person singular present légno, first-person singular past historic legnài, past participle legnàto, auxiliary avére) (transitive)

  1. (informal) to beat with a stick
  2. (informal) to defeat overwhelmingly
Conjugation

Etymology 2

From Latin lignārī.

Verb

legnàre (first-person singular present légno, first-person singular past historic legnài, past participle legnàto, auxiliary avére) (intransitive)

  1. (archaic) to gather firewood [auxiliary avere]
